Ochazuke ya β Japan's most comforting and simple dining concept β are found at dedicated ochazuke restaurants, izakayas, and Japanese establishments throughout Japan. Ochazuke specializes in rice bowls that combine steamed rice with green tea, toppings, and seasonings. An ochazuke ya business captures this comforting appeal while offering a product with exceptional margins, high perceived value, and a loyal following.
Starting an ochazuke ya business requires mastering the art of the perfect ochazuke β the proper rice selection, the precise tea brewing technique, and the toppings that create the signature savory flavor profile. Step 2: Perfect Your Ochazuke Ya Recipe
Rice Preparation β Use short-grain Japanese rice, cooked to the proper texture. The rice should be fluffy and slightly sticky.
Tea Preparation β The green tea should be freshly brewed and at the proper temperature. The tea should be flavorful but not bitter.
Topping Selection β The toppings should be fresh and flavorful. Salmon should be cooked to the proper doneness. Seaweed should be crisp and fresh.
Assembly Technique β Master the art of assembling the ochazuke with proper proportions of rice, tea, and toppings. The assembly should be consistent for every batch.
